#5554a9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5554a9 is composed of 33.3% red, 32.9% green and 66.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.7% cyan, 50.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 240.7 degrees, a saturation of 33.6% and a lightness of 49.6%. #5554a9 color hex could be obtained by blending #aaa8ff with #000053.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

Shades and Tints of #5554a9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06060c is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#5554a9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b7b82 is the less saturated color, while #0906f7 is the most saturated one.
